AAR VP Jack Arehart to Speak at Argyle Executive Forum

March 13, 2013
 

Aerospace marketing officer to talk about changing roles

WOOD DALE, Illinois – AAR Vice President and Co-Chief Commercial Officer Jack Arehart will provide insights on how the role of the marketing officer has changed in today’s more competitive, consumer-savvy market at the 2013 Chief Marketing Officer Leadership Forum, hosted by the Argyle Executive Forum on Thursday at the Standard Club in Chicago.

Arehart, who is in charge of developing marketing strategies for global sales and expansion into new markets for AAR, will be joined on the panel by three other marketing executives. The forum attracts business leaders from various industry sectors ranging from healthcare to entertainment to the retail market. Argyle Executive Forum brings together business leaders from highly targeted business-to-business communities to strategize and collaborate on business development.

“My focus will be on doing more with less in the current economy and driving deeper customer engagement through new technologies to reach customers who can benefit from our services,” Arehart said. “Outreach leads to access and helps businesses gain traction, especially as they expand into global new markets.”

Arehart graduated with an economics degree from the University of North Carolina at Greensboro and a Master’s of Science from St. Thomas University in Miami.

Argyle Executive Forum is a professional services firm committed to advancing new ideas and timely perspectives among senior-level officers and executive decision-makers. It has more than 40,000 members.

About AAR

AAR is a global aftermarket solutions company that employs more than 6,000 people in over 20 countries. Based in Wood Dale, Illinois, AAR supports commercial aviation and government customers through two operating segments: Aviation Services and Expeditionary Services. AAR’s Aviation Services include inventory management; parts supply; OEM parts distribution; aircraft maintenance, repair and overhaul; engineering services and component repair. AAR’s Expeditionary Services include airlift operations; mobility systems; and command and control centers in support of military and humanitarian missions.
